The big market slump this week is accompanied by a wave of whale activities. At the time of the crash, Bitcoin Whales moved 37,225 BTC or $325.5 million. Now, another Ripple whale joined and moved over 250,000,000 XRP.

The largest among the sighted gentle giants transferred 10,000 BTC worth $86.8 million between two wallets of unknown provenance.

Probably this Bitcoin Whale was a trader who moved his assets from one wallet to another for security reasons. It could also have been a smaller exchange or an over-the-counter (OTC) sale between two private parties.

At the same day, a powerful Ripple specimen joined the “game”. A Ripple whale has recently transferred 250,000,000 XRP tokens worth over $67 million.

The Wallet in question does not seem to belong to Ripple. However, the XRP tokens have not yet been moved to an exchange where they could be traded on the open market.

However, because of the recent massive XRP sales by Ripple itself, the community is now very allergic to all major XRP movements in the market.
